6 Ways To Do Graphic Eyeliner

Classic, sharp flick extending from the outer corner; adds drama and elongates the eye.

Winged Eyeliner

Two parallel lines extending from the outer corner; creates a bold, edgy look.

Double Winged Eyeliner

Sharp line following the crease of the eyelid; defines and enhances eye shape dramatically.

Cut Crease Eyeliner

Bold outline with a gap in the middle; modern, artistic, and visually striking.

Negative Space Eyeliner

Line drawn above the crease, not touching the lash line; unique and futuristic style.

Floating Eyeliner

Geometric designs, like triangles or squares, around the eyes; creative and avant-garde appearance.

Geometric Shapes
